| Airline | Free hand luggage weight allowance | Hand luggage size |
|---|---|---|
| British Airways | Up to 23kg in one bag, plus one personal bag or laptop bag up to 23kg. | Cabin bag: 56 x 45 x 25cm Personal item: 40 x 30 x 15cm |
| Virgin Atlantic | Up to 10kg in one bag, plus a personal item, such as a handbag or small backpack. | 56 x 36 x 23cm |

How big is a Ryanair 10kg bag?
55cm x 40cm x 20cm
3 If you purchased the 10kg Check-In Bag (up to 10kg with maximum dimensions of 55cm x 40cm x 20cm) you may carry your small bag on board the aircraft, however the 10kg Check-In Bag must be deposited at the bag-drop desk prior to entering security.
Do you know the size of your hand luggage?
Before your trip, it’s important to make sure you know your airline’s hand luggage size and weight restrictions as they vary from airline to airline and going over them, even slightly, can result in a hefty fine. Even if you’ve travelled recently, double check your allowances as they can change.

Is it better to take hand luggage on holiday?
Taking hand luggage instead of checked baggage on holiday generally allows you to avoid checked-in baggage charges. However, you must always check the weights and costs of individual airlines before you fly.
